Mistyped links to Hillary Clinton’s presidential campaign website now redirect web users to a GIF of the Democrat trying to get her MetroCard to work so she can go through a subway turnstile in the Bronx last Thursday.
The campaign is making light of the critics who say that, as the former U.S. Senator from New York, she should have been able to swipe it correctly on the first try.
At one point last year, her campaign’s 404 page featured a family photo of Bill, Hillary, and a young Chelsea wearing Donald Duck hats and posing with someone dressed as the Disney character. See her 404 pages and other creative ones in TIME.com’s round-up of the funniest error pages below.
